Both classes are Sampler quilts. The first one is a great class for beginners, those who want to brush up on their skills and learn some new techniques, or make a sampler. it is truly a sampler of techniques — both hand and machine. Class begins May 14th.
Here’s the quilt for QuiltMaking 101:
The class is ten lessons and you can login whenever it’s convenient for YOU, as is the case with all my classes. I want to make it easy for you.
Here is the Quilter’s Palette:
This class is 11 lessons. It’s a sampler of machine techniques, and is the next “step” after QuiltMaking 101, if you’ve already taken that class with me. There are no prerequisites for this class, except that you have to be a confident beginner. Some of the blocks look really simple, (and they start out that way…) but they can be deceivingly simple too ; ) Class begins May 1st.
